Built-in Screen Recording
Best free method for Android users
Most Android devices include native screen recording that captures WhatsApp video calls with audio. This is the simplest and most reliable free method.
How to Use:
- Swipe down to open Quick Settings
- Tap “Screen recording” (add it if not visible)
- Select audio source (microphone + internal audio if available)
- Start your WhatsApp call, then begin recording
- Stop recording from notification panel
✅ Pros
- Completely free
- No app installation required
- Records both video and audio
- Works on most Android devices
❌ Cons
- Audio quality varies by device
- May not capture internal audio on all phones
- Limited editing options
iPhone + Mac QuickTime
Best method for iOS users with Mac
Connect your iPhone to Mac via cable and use QuickTime Player to record high-quality WhatsApp calls with both video and audio.
Setup Process:
- Connect iPhone to Mac with USB cable
- Open QuickTime Player on Mac
- Go to File > New Movie Recording
- Select iPhone as camera and microphone source
- Start recording, then make your WhatsApp call
✅ Pros
- Excellent recording quality
- No additional apps needed
- Direct Mac storage
- Free solution
❌ Cons
- Requires both iPhone and Mac
- Wired connection needed
- Setup required before each call

Second Device Recording
Simple backup method for any platform
Use any secondary device to record WhatsApp calls through speakerphone - the most private recording method.
How to Use:
- Place WhatsApp call on speakerphone
- Position second device near phone speaker
- Start voice recording app on second device
- Record the entire conversation
- Transfer file to preferred storage
✅ Pros
- No app installation required
- Works with any device combination
- Completely private
- No internet connection needed
❌ Cons
- Lower audio quality
- Background noise interference
- Manual operation required

Legal Considerations
Before recording any WhatsApp calls, understand the legal requirements and privacy implications in your jurisdiction.
Recording Laws by Region
One-Party Consent:
- United States (varies by state)
- United Kingdom (with limitations)
- Only one person needs to consent
Two-Party Consent Required:
- California, Florida, Pennsylvania (US)
- Germany, France (EU)
- All parties must consent
